Charlie Puth Joins AI Startup Suno to Innovate Music Creation

by | Mar 5, 2026


The intersection of music creation and artificial intelligence continues to accelerate, as chart-topping pop artist Charlie Puth steps into a strategic role at AI music startup Suno. This move underscores the rapidly expanding influence of generative AI in creative workflows, shifting how artists, developers, and businesses engage with music technology.

Musicians Drive AI Adoption in Creative Industries

Major artists are no longer just using AI tools—they’re helping to shape them, with direct influence on product direction and industry standards.

Charlie Puth’s new executive post at Suno reflects a broader trend: influential musicians are deepening their involvement with artificial intelligence startups. Suno, a Cambridge-based AI company focusing on “text-to-music” models, stands to benefit from Puth’s expertise in music theory, production, and mainstream pop trends. In return, his influence could help Suno refine its AI models for greater musicality, authenticity, and artist adoption. According to Billboard and other industry sources, Suno has raised significant venture capital to advance generative music applications, with an aim to empower both amateur and professional creators.
